The Risks and Consequences of Ignoring Sustainable Building Practices
The construction industry is a significant contributor to environmental degradation, accounting for approximately 40% of global energy-related CO2 emissions. This alarming statistic underscores the urgent need for sustainable building practices that minimize ecological impact while ensuring structural integrity and durability. Unfortunately, many owners in Bali often overlook these critical considerations, leading to several adverse consequences. Firstly, neglecting sustainable materials such as bamboo can result in increased carbon footprints. Traditional construction methods typically involve the extensive use of concrete, steel, and other non-renewable resources. These materials require substantial amounts of energy during production, transport, and disposal, contributing significantly to greenhouse gas emissions. For example, cement production alone is responsible for around 8% of global CO2 emissions, making it a major contributor to climate change. Moreover, the extraction and processing of raw materials like sand, gravel, and limestone used in concrete can have devastating environmental impacts. Dredging rivers and coastal areas for aggregates can disrupt aquatic ecosystems, while quarrying operations often lead to soil erosion, deforestation, and loss of biodiversity. Steel production also poses significant environmental risks due to its high energy consumption and reliance on fossil fuels.
